2 Our Approach

Our primary insight is that a user may decrease the performance penalty they pay for employing a cryptographic file system by using only part of the key for cryptographic operations. The rest of the key may be used to unpredictably spread the data into the file’s address space. Note that we are not necessarily fragmenting the placement of the data on disk, but rather mixing the placement of the data within the file.

2.1 Key Composition: Maintaining Confidentiality

While our goal is to mitigate the performance penalty paid for using a cryptographic file system, it is not advisable to trade confidentiality for performance. Instead, we argue thatkeys can be made effectively longer without incurring the usual performance penalty. One obvious method of reducing the performance penalty for encrypting files is to utilize a cipher with a shorter key length; however, there is a corresponding loss of confidentiality with a shorter key length. We address the tradeoff between key length and performance by extending the key with “spreading bits,” and exploiting the properties of an indexed allocation file system.
